8:20 a.m. -- LittleBigPlanet to be released on the 29th of October in the PAL territories. Host has high hopes for this game, as do I. Speaker is also pleased to announced a wireless keypad for PS3. It latches on to the top of the controller, kinda' like the 360 keypad, except for the top instead of the bottom. In my opinion, it looks a little bit... gigantic. It will be released in 8 different langauges. The keypad will also have mouse input as well, which could be quite handy.
8:19 a.m. -- Play TV launched on the 19th of September. I believe that's just for European territories though, no word on the US for Play TV, a video playback program.
8:18 a.m. -- Speaker says they're announcing a special, limited edition 160 GB PS3 with the same specs, just more HD space. Priced 449 Euros. Will include 70 Euros of additional downloadable game content
8:16 a.m. -- The host talks shortly about Kaz Hirai. I think I can speak for all of us when I say that Kaz is the man. So, PS3 has a great year. Sales have grown to over 14 million worldwide, and 5.8 million through the end of July -- that's in the PAL territories. Friday of this week, 80 gig PS3 available!!!!! 399 Euros.

8:11 a.m. -- PSP 3000 will launch on the 15th of October for 199 Euros with one-game bundles. Eight Bundles will be included. Harry Potter, Buzz Master Quiz, Go Messenger, FIFA 09 Slim and Lite will then be priced at 169 Euros. Keep in mind kids, that's Euros, not USD. It will be more expensive here, in a way.
8:09 a.m. -- In addition, the PSP 3000 has a built-in microphone. Along with Skype and Go Messenger, this will make it a "reliable communication device."
8:09 a.m. -- It brings you all the functionality of the old PSP, looks the same, actually... hmm. Hm, the LCD screen is "enhanced" He's explaining what that means. The intensity of colors have been increased. Crisper colors in outside natural light, reducing glare. Screens for the win!
8:08 a.m. -- Monster Hunter Portable 2nd G is named as a big game recently, as well as Crisis Core. By the way, if you haven't played Crisis Core yet, do so. PSP 3000!!!!!!! On man, here it is!!!!
8:07 a.m. -- PSP is discussed. And it's importance to the PAL territories. PSP and its software library have been a huge success here. 41 million worldwide install base. Wicked!.
